Mere Abrams, LCSW

Mere Abrams is a consultant, coach, therapist, & licensed clinical social worker serving clients throughout California.

Mere received an undergraduate degree in Community-Based Research from Pitzer College and a Master’s in Social Work from the Smith College School for Social Work. Mere pulls from current research, professional guidelines, specialized training, and community knowledge in their education and support services.

Mere previously worked at the University of San Francisco, California, Child and Adolescent Gender Center as the Director of Community Engagement and Associate Director of Clinical Research, developing and managing programs sponsored by the San Francisco Department of Public Health and the National Institute of Health. Mere has partnered with Gender Spectrum, GLSEN, Advocates for Youth, Healthline Media, Frameline Media, Modern Fertility, and many other businesses organizations to increase understanding about gender diversity, develop resources, and provide direct support to queer, trans/transgender, and non-binary people.
